  1. What are your greatest strengths?

    • Answer: My greatest strengths are my problem-solving abilities and my dedication to teamwork. I excel at identifying the root cause of issues and finding creative solutions. I also thrive in collaborative environments and believe that the best results are achieved through effective teamwork and communication.
  2. What are your greatest weaknesses?

    • Answer: I sometimes tend to be a perfectionist, which can occasionally lead to spending too much time on a single task. However, I am actively working on improving my time management skills and prioritizing tasks to maintain a healthy work-life balance.
